Theta Network Launches EdgeCloud Beta, Unveils Hybrid GPU Platform
HomeNews* THETA Network is launching the beta version of EdgeCloud’s hybrid edge-cloud computing platform on June 25, 2025.
"EdgeCloud’s hybrid architecture balances computing workloads between high-end cloud servers and a global network of edge nodes," states Theta Labs. This structure allows for flexible, scalable, and lower-cost computing solutions for tasks like AI model inference, 3D rendering, financial simulations, and video transcoding.
EdgeCloud participants can set their own hourly rental rates for contributed GPUs using the platform’s decentralized marketplace. Developers and users choose nodes that best fit their requirements and budget. Supported GPUs range from consumer models, such as NVIDIA 3070s, to enterprise-grade A100s and H100s. The system uses containerized jobs, allowing a variety of computational workloads to run reliably across hardware types.
The EdgeCloud beta will feature job orchestration—a system that distributes tasks based on node performance—failover support for improved reliability, and an API for developers to submit and track jobs. According to Theta Labs, future updates will allow users to further customize node preferences and access detailed analytics dashboards.
To join the network, contributors need a compatible Nvidia GPU (8GB vRAM or higher), a recent operating system (like Ubuntu 22.04 or Windows 10/11 for preview testers), a CPU with at least 4 cores, 16GB RAM, 256GB storage, and a stable 100 Mbps or faster internet connection. Monthly rewards for running jobs or offering on-demand model inference are distributed at the beginning of each month.
